The Editors of Encyclopaedia Britannica Last Updated: Sep. 19, 2025 •Article History Table of Contents Table of Contents Ask the Chatbot There are several dogs that are closely associated with dingoes, including the rare Carolina Dog and the wild New Guinea singing dog. But the Australian Cattle Dog is the dog breed that was developed in the 19th century by crossing a Blue Merle Collie with a dingo. Breeders sought to imbue the emerging breed with the dingo’s natural herding instincts, specifically its tendency to nip at the heels of livestock (which is why Australian Cattle Dogs are sometimes called Heelers).
